OUR bard, advent'ring to the comic land,
Directs his choice by Shakespeare's happier hand;
Shakespeare! who warms with more than magic art,
Enchants the ear, whilst he inspires the heart;
Yet should he fail, he hopes, the wits will own,
There's enough of Shakespeare's still, to please the town.
THE STUDENTS. A Comedy, altered from
Shakespeare's "Love's Labour's Lost,"
and adapted for the stage. MDCCLXII.
